Our History
1968
Bold Beginnings
After more than a decade of real estate development in Durham, Charles Russell Wellons, together with his wife Geneelia, founded Real Estate Associates, Inc. (REA) to expand and formalize their growing portfolio. They began work in Durham with residential subdivisions and commercial ventures, including Wellons Village — a combined residential community and shopping center that became only the second of its kind in the city.
REA’s first office was located on Miami Blvd, not far from Wellons Village, reflecting the company’s deep roots in East Durham. The success of these early developments helped establish the Wellons name as a prominent force in shaping Durham’s suburban growth and laid the groundwork for what would become one of the area’s most enduring real estate firms.

1972
Expanding Horizons
Joe Jernigan joined Real Estate Associates and eventually assumed the role of President in 1979, guiding the company through a period of strategic expansion.
Under his leadership, REA broadened its focus beyond development to include the acquisition of land and investment property, and third-party property management services. The firm soon established a reputation for hands-on expertise and client-first service that continues to define the firm today.

1989
New Home Base
As Real Estate Associates grew, the company relocated its office to 3633 Durham-Chapel Hill Blvd in South Durham, where it purchased and occupied a former bank building. The site featured a drive-thru, which proved especially convenient for residents paying rent in person.
This move reflected the company’s continued expansion and its commitment to providing accessible, community-focused service across a growing portfolio of properties.

1993
Flagship Development
Under the leadership of Joe Jernigan, Real Estate Associates developed Falconbridge Shopping Center in Chapel Hill - a 70,000 square foot retail hub anchored by Mardi Gras Bowling, the town’s only public bowling center. The project quickly became a high-profile success and a flagship property in REA’s portfolio. With its prominent location and community-driven tenant mix, Falconbridge demonstrated the firm’s ability to deliver impactful, destination-oriented developments that served both neighborhood needs and long-term investment goals.

2003
Family Business
Seth Jernigan, son of then-President Joe Jernigan, joined the company in 2003, bringing fresh energy to the commercial brokerage division and business development efforts.
He began his career at Accenture, a global management consulting firm in Charlotte, NC, where he honed a disciplined project management approach to navigating complex business challenges.
Seth’s blend of corporate consulting expertise and local market focus helped drive the firm’s growth and expansion.

2009
Positioned for Growth
As the company continued to grow, Real Estate Associates acquired a larger building at 3333 Durham-Chapel Hill Boulevard and relocated its offices once again. The move provided expanded space to support its growing team, including the addition of more commercial brokers. This strategic investment reflected REA’s commitment to long-term growth and its evolving role as a full-service real estate firm.

2022
Global Reach
REA becomes SVN | Real Estate Associates, joining forces with SVN, a globally recognized commercial real estate brand with more than 200 offices worldwide.
This powerful partnership extends SVN | REA's reach far beyond North Carolina while deepening its commitment to delivering local expertise with world‑class resources.
